USOlympics Ugly Sweater

The U.S. Olympics Team is Gonna Win the Ugly Christmas Sweater Contest

As if the upcoming 2014 Sochi Winter Olympics weren’t already steeped in ugliness from Russia’s terrible anti-gay laws. AS IF. All that madness wasn’t enough. The U.S. Olympics team is adding to the ugly with their uniforms, designed by the Silver Fox, Ralph Lauren. WUT?!? I mean what in the …